Demand for Certificates
LONDON, Dee. 18. Nutlonal s'av
Iiirs certificate sold to November
II, total C01, 479,281 pounds sterl
ing. When tho certificates wore
changed from 15 shillings and G
penrn In 1C shillings, tlicre was a
temporary lull, but slnco there has
been a sharp Increase In demand,
nnd tho certificates are now one of
tho most popular Investments la tho
country. Fcr each sixteen shillings
Invested, tho buyer get one. pound
sterling at the end Of flvo years.

10 CONSUiaTllS CI.OSITI)
VLADISVOTOK. Dee., 18. Tho
soviet government ot Vladivostok,
which recently took over tho admin
istration of city and surrounding ter
ritory, known ns tho Prlmorla, to
day ordered the consuls of Franca
and 10 olhor countries to clou,, Jliclr
consulates and. lcavo within ntio
week. The consulates ot tho Unlt'jd
States, Oreat Hrltaln, Italy, Ger
many and Austria wore "not order
ed closed.
